The Launch Abort System (LAS): A Critical Safety Mechanism

The Blue Origin Launch Abort System (LAS) is a crucial safety feature designed to protect the crew in the event of an emergency during launch or ascent. This sophisticated escape system, also referred to as an escape system, is paramount to ensuring spacecraft safety. It's an intricate network of components working in concert to rapidly separate the crew capsule from the main rocket should a critical failure occur. Key components include the escape motor, responsible for propelling the capsule away from the malfunctioning rocket, and the escape tower, which houses the motor and provides structural support.

  • Escape Scenarios: The LAS is designed to handle a range of scenarios, from engine failures to structural issues, ensuring crew safety even during catastrophic events.
  • System Redundancy: Blue Origin incorporates significant redundancy within the LAS. Multiple systems are in place, functioning as backups to enhance reliability and minimize the risk of a complete system failure during a critical event.
  • Previous Successes: While this recent incident marks a failure, previous test flights have successfully demonstrated the functionality of the Blue Origin LAS, showcasing its capability to rapidly and safely separate the crew capsule in simulated emergency conditions.

Identifying the Subsystem Failure: Pinpointing the Problem

Following the Blue Origin launch abort, the company released initial reports indicating a subsystem failure triggered the automatic abort sequence. The exact nature of this "Subsystem Failure" remains under investigation. Blue Origin is conducting a thorough root cause analysis, utilizing a comprehensive approach that combines data analysis from various onboard sensors, simulations to recreate the flight conditions, and meticulous examination of the recovered hardware. This rigorous investigation is essential not only for understanding the immediate cause of this specific event but also for enhancing future mission safety.

  • Potential Causes: While definitive conclusions are pending, the investigation will likely explore a range of potential causes, from software glitches to hardware malfunctions. Speculation at this stage is premature and could be misleading.
  • Data Analysis and Simulations: Engineers are meticulously analyzing vast amounts of data collected during the launch, leveraging sophisticated simulations to reconstruct the events leading up to the abort.
  • Investigation Timeline: Blue Origin has committed to a transparent and thorough investigation, promising to release their findings publicly once the root cause is definitively identified. The timeline for completion remains to be seen but is expected to be comprehensive.
